Changes the sequence name generator to handle cases where PostgreSQL auto-generated sequence name differed from TypeORM generated sequence name.
Closes: #7106
Description of change
Current behaviour: sequence name generator for PostgreSQL does not match PostgreSQL automatic sequence name implementation for some cases.
New behaviour: now it does.
